Hint: For solving these problems, we need to have a clear understanding about the concept of whole numbers and their various properties. Using the properties of multiplication, we can easily solve \[50\times 102\] and get to the correct answer.
Complete step by step answer:
The whole numbers are the part of the number system in which it includes all the positive integers from zero to infinity. These numbers exist in the number line. Hence, they are all real numbers. We can say, all the whole numbers are real numbers, but not all the real numbers are whole numbers. The complete set of natural numbers along with zero are called whole numbers. The examples are:
\[0,11,25,36,999,1200,\text{ }etc.\]
The properties of whole numbers are based on arithmetic operations such as addition, subtraction, division and multiplication. Two whole numbers if added or multiplied will give a whole number itself. Subtraction of two whole numbers may not result in whole numbers, i.e., it can be an integer too. Also, division of two whole numbers results in getting a fraction in some cases.
The sum and product of two whole numbers will be the same whatever the order they are added or multiplied in is called the commutative property of addition and multiplication, i.e., if x and y are two whole numbers, then \[x+y=y+x\] and \[x\times y\text{ }=\text{ }y\times x\] .
Associative property states that when whole numbers are being added or multiplied as a set, they can be grouped in any order, and the result will be the same, i.e. if x, y and z are whole numbers then \[x+\left( y+z \right)=\left( x+y \right)\text{+}z\] and \[x\times \left( y\times z \right)=\left( x\times y \right)\times z\] .
Distributive property of multiplication over the addition of whole numbers is:
\[x\times \left( y+z \right)=\left( x\times y \right)+\left( x\times z \right)\]
Employing this property to solve 50×102 we get that
$\Rightarrow 50\times 102=50\times \left( 100+2 \right)=50\times 100+50\times 2=5000+100=5100$
Hence, by employing the properties of whole numbers we get that the answer to the given question is $5100$ .
